Medal-winning, record-setting gymnast from Utah inducted into Hall of Fame after paralyzation
SANPETE COUNTY, Utah — Kalon Ludvigson, a gymnast originally from Utah who broke world tumbling records before becoming paralyzed in a devastating accident nine years ago, has now been inducted into the Hall of Fame and given an even more special honor because of what he’s done after his gymnastics career.
He kept mastering the skill of tumbling, a talent that eventually took him to the world stage. But first, his mom said, there were those twice-a-week, five-hour round-trip drives to the nearest training facility, which was in Ogden.He overcame logistical challenges when he made Team USA — the youngest ever at just 16.“I definitely loved it. It was anything and everything, it was all I wanted to do, it was what I thought of when I went to bed and first when I woke up.
He was also the first person in several years to receive the Spirit of the Flame award — an honor he received in Florida last month where he was inducted into the Gymnastics Hall of Fame. His mom said she just hopes her son’s story inspires someone to live their dream no matter what challenges they may face, saying she can’t wait to see what he does next.
